ホームページ > ウェブフロントエンド > フロントエンドQ&A > vue 3d 回転フォト アルバムのソース コードの使用方法

vue 3d 回転フォト アルバムのソース コードの使用方法

PHPz
リリース: 2023-04-12 11:23:37
オリジナル
976 人が閲覧しました

Vue 3D 回転フォト アルバム ソース コード: Vue.js を使用してサムネイルを作成し、3D 回転効果を使用して Web ページ上に写真を表示します。

デジタル時代では、ほとんどの人が携帯電話を使用して何千枚もの写真を保存しています。私たちはこれらの写真を Web ページに美しい方法で表示できるようにしたいと考えています。

Vue 3D 回転フォト アルバムは、この問題を解決する理想的な方法です。 Vue.js フレームワークと WebGL テクノロジーを使用して、3D 回転効果に基づいた写真表示ツールを作成します。

インストールと使用

インストール

この Vue 3D 回転フォト アルバムのソース コードを実行するには、Vue.js と WebGL をインストールする必要があります。

npm を使用します

npm install vue
npm install vue-webgl

yarn を使用します

yarn add vue
yarn add vue-webgl

使用方法

Vue 3D を使用してアルバムを回転する方法は非常に簡単です。まず、Vue コンポーネントに vue-webgl をインポートし、アルバム構成を設定する必要があります。

import WebGLAlbum from 'vue-webgl-album';

export default {
data( ) {

return {
  config: {
    autoRotate: true,
    images: [
      {
        src: 'image0.jpg',
        label: 'Image 0',
        description: 'The first image',
      },
      {
        src: 'image1.jpg',
        label: 'Image 1',
        description: 'The second image',
      },
      // add more images here
    ],
  },
};
ログイン後にコピー

},
コンポーネント: { WebGLAlbum },
};

次に、Vue コンポーネントのテンプレートでフォト アルバムを作成します。

これらの構成変数を編集することで、次のことを制御できます。アルバムの外観と動作。たとえば、autoplay パラメータを「true」または「false」に設定することで自動回転のオン/オフを制御できます。spinSpeed パラメータを設定してフォト アルバムの回転速度を調整し、幅と高さのパラメータを次のように設定します。フォトアルバムのサイズなどを決めます。

{
  src: 'image0.jpg',
  label: 'Image 0',
  description: 'The first image',
},
{
  src: 'image1.jpg',
  label: 'Image 1',
  description: 'The second image',
},
// add more images here
ログイン後にコピー

],
width: '100%',
height: '500px',
}" />

結論

Vue 3D 回転フォト アルバムのソース コードはこのソリューションは Vue.js と互換性があり、3D スタイルのフォト アルバムを簡単に作成できます。写真作品を紹介する Web サイトをデザインしている場合は、Vue 3D 回転フォト アルバム ソース コードが最適です。

以上がvue 3d 回転フォト アルバムのソース コードの使用方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のおすすめ
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ート